Dong-ling-cao (Isodon rubescens), potted plant, organic
$8.50
Family: Mint (Lamiaceae)
Hardy to zone 8 to 11
(Blushred Rabdosia) Herbaceous perennial native to China. The crown is tough and clumping, not spreading. In zones 8 and 9, the plant acts like an herbaceous perennial. In zones 10 and 11, a woody perennial bush. The flowers are long-lasting and showy. The foliage emits the fragrance of basil and pine. Traditional usage (TCM): Breast cancer. Source of diterpenoic molecule oridonin. Plant prefers normal garden conditions, with sun and regular watering. These are pretty on a border and tend to size themselves well in potted culture. I have had them live for years in pots with little attention, also perennialize solidly and make sturdy bushes in outdoor culture. Space plants 3 feet apart.
